What did James do when Snape called Lily a Mudblood?

When Snape called Lily a “filthy Mudblood” in a fit of anger and humiliation when she defended him from his bullies (including James and Sirius), it was the last straw for Lily. When she later asked him if he still intended to become a Death Eater and he did not deny it, she severed all ties with him.

What did Snape say to Umbridge when he asked what Harry was talking?

When Umbridge asks Snape what Harry is talking about, Snape convincingly tells Professor Umbridge he had no idea. His comment was so convincing that Harry himself was almost worried that Snape was betraying him. Snape gave Harry no reassurance in any way, and although it was petty, fans can’t deny this moment was laughable.

Is Snape the most bullied character in the Harry Potter series?

In the Harry Potter universe, Severus Snape is one of the most despised, beloved and easy to rip on characters. He is literally the most bullied adult in the series, having been the subject of the Marauders’ mean mirth for years, yet he becomes one of the biggest bullies as an adult.
